Description: Modification of the Frontera Hydroelectric Power Plant Transmission System High-voltage power transmission lines The Project submitted for environmental assessment consists of modifying the layout of the high-voltage transmission line (hereinafter LAT) associated with the “Frontera Hydroelectric Power Plant” project. , environmentally approved and that has an Environmental Qualification Resolution (hereinafter RCA) in force through RE No. 071/2016 of February 12, 2016. The originally approved project contemplated, in general, a 1x220 kV simple circuit HTL, of 8 kilometers (km) in length and 27 structures (hereinafter "towers"), whose layout began in the High Voltage Yard of the Power Plant and whose electrical energy would be delivered to the Central Interconnected System (SIC), through a future substation that would section the existing Charrúa – Temuco 1x220 kV line owned by the company Transelec SA Subsequently, through the Relevance Consultation, pre Seated at the Environmental Assessment Service on September 3, 2018, the original layout of the LAT of the "Frontera Hydroelectric Power Plant" project is modified. Said modification to the original project consists of the elimination of the last 2 towers, leaving a total of 25; and establishing the change of the connection point where the electrical energy will be injected to the current National Electric System (hereinafter SEN). In accordance with this, the new electric power delivery point will be made through the connection with the LAT San Carlos – S/E Mulchén, a project approved environmentally and with RCA in force through RE No. 142/2017 of April 26 of the year. 2017. The LAT proposed and submitted for evaluation through this DIA maintains the characteristics of a simple circuit (1x220 kVA), the starting point of the layout, that is, the High Voltage Yard of the Power Plant and the connection point for the delivery of electric energy (LAT San Carlos – S/E Mulchén). However, this modification contemplates a change in the layout by adding 5 towers to the LAT, which translates into a total of 30 towers, and a length of 8.56 km. The associated easement strip contemplates a width of 50 m in total, 25 m on each side of the axis of the layout, the same as the LAT originally approved through RE No. 071/2016. The objective of the Project is the modification of the layout of the LAT associated with the "Frontera Hydroelectric Power Plant" project, environmentally approved and with RCA in force through RE No. 071/2016 of February 12, 2016, which presents a modification, entered into the Service of Environmental Assessment dated September 3, 2018. In this way, the modification that is presented for environmental assessment contemplates a change in the layout and number of towers that translates into a total of 30 towers, and a total length of the LAT of 8 .56km
